The bottom margin should be at 1 inch as well, though it … how to move your plex serverWebSep 1, 2010 · When quoting a long passage involving more than one paragraph, quotation marks go at the beginning of each paragraph, but at the end of only the final one. Dialogue in which the speaker changes with each paragraph has each speech enclosed in its own quotation marks.
